And we do continue with the breaking news, Scrat Cdemocrati senator Dianne Feinstein has passed away at the age of 90 years old. We have of course seen the senators struggles with her health in recent years, she has been previously hospitalized in august after a fall. We now want to get to Cnns Wolf Blitzer who is taking a look back at her life and incredible legacy. Announcer Dianne Feinstein emerged on the National Stage after a 1978 tragedy in San Francisco. Mayor moss coney and supervisor harvey milk have been shot and killed. Reporter after the Assassinations Feinstein was sworn in as the first female mayor of the city by the bay.
